NJ To Appeal Kiddie Kollege [1]

"The New Jersey Department of Environmental Protection announced yesterday that it would appeal a court ruling that the owner of the Kiddie Kollege building in Franklin Township, Gloucester County, is not responsible for its $1 million cleanup."
Source: Philadelphia Inquirer [2], 05/08/2009

Obama Insists: Auction CO2 Permits [3]

"President Barack Obama's $3.55 trillion budget, released on Thursday, retains his plan to cut climate-warming carbon dioxide emissions by auctioning off 100 percent of emission permits to industries."
Source: Reuters [4], 05/08/2009

EPA Hid Risks Of Coal Ash: Report [5]

"The Bush administration kept secret for nearly five years data that showed increased cancer risks from drinking water polluted by coal-ash impoundments...."
Source: Charleston Gazette [6], 05/08/2009

Obama Has Yet To End PIO "Minders," Permissions [12]

A new report from the Union of Concerned Scientists documents the Obama administration's declarations that it intends to be more open. But the same report also documents the many actions not taken at the agency level.

Congress Chiefs Want Probe into Secret Bayer Poison Gas [13]

House Energy Chair Waxman and Senate Commerce Chair Rockefeller call for investigation of whether Bayer could use safer chemicals at its Institute WV plant.

SEJ, Groups Ask Environment Canada for Openness [14]

Environment Canada ignored a similar letter from SEJ sent a year ago, requesting restoration of public access to science that taxpayers have paid for.
